Valerie Maurice Ebe[1] (née Bassey, amụrụ na 26 Machị 1947), bụ onye ọka iwụ n'onye ndọrọ ndọrọ ọchịchị Naijiria bụ nwanyị mbụ osote gọvanọ nke Akwa Ibom Steeti.[2]

Mbido ndụ na agụmakwụkwọ[dezie | dezie ebe o si]

A mụrụ Ebe na 26 Machị 1947 n'aka Edidem Paul Bassey, onye ọchịchị mpaghara nke Etoi Clan. Ọ gara ụlọ akwụkwọ praịmarị Holy Child, Calabar ma nabata ya na Holy Child Secondary School, Calabar na 1957 maka agụmakwụkwọ ụlọ akwụkwọ sekọndrị ya. O mechara zụọ ịbụ onye nkuzi na Holy Child Teacher Training College, Ifuho. O gụrụ akụkọ ihe mere eme na nkà mmụta ihe ochie na Mahadum Naịjịrịa, Nsukka ma mesịa mụọ iwu na Mahadim Uyo . A nabatara ya dị ka onye ọka iwu na onye ọka iwu nke Ụlọikpe Kasị Elu nke Naịjirịa na 1998.[1]
